Overview

Explore a real-world approach to enterprise-wide, multi-factor authentication deployment at a Fortune 500 financial services company with over 30,000 employees in this AppSecUSA 2017 conference talk. Delve into the technical challenges of adapting modern passwordless authentication protocols like SAML and Kerberos to a diverse range of client computing devices and legacy technologies. Learn about critical user experience decisions and lessons from implementing workforce authentication for any time, place, and device. Gain insights from speakers Matt Hajda, Security Architect at USAA, and Michael Stewart, Executive Director of IAM at USAA, as they share their expertise in identity and access management, covering topics such as mobile authentication, market texture, organizational challenges, and in-office MFA implementation.
